Transaction 721fef6374236d14a637dfae8ac89e8a109159d3dd524d761878ea0d6dbd15ec

1 Input
2 Outputs
  • 721fef6374236d14a637dfae8ac89e8a109159d3dd524d761878ea0d6dbd15ec:0
  • value  36541946
    address  bc1q2tmrme32fw8ewzuq3dq2j96pxg5wktpdsnctn0
  • 721fef6374236d14a637dfae8ac89e8a109159d3dd524d761878ea0d6dbd15ec:1
  • value  1680264
    address  3Dxr7e46prALNuqchTcoivNyQr9fxDKhmx